    March 6, 2024 - Opened and left in bottle, then cooled again to be brought out later.

    Golden appearance but no signs of premox.
    Silky and fresh without being especially bright on the nose. Hints of wax and nut, honeycomb. There is a cool freshness and an elegance.

    Good volume, some nut and nougat flavour, ginger - burnt biscuit, manzanilla salt and nut on the finish. Feels plenty fresh, nice acidity a little burnt hair/roasted-salted nut length... Elegant and delicate.

    On return:
    Some light butterscotch to the nose, butter, good lift and freshness. Some alcohol. Barest hint of burnt hair (seems to be getting cleaner as it breathes), cream, mineral pools. Clean.

    Palate shows a broad silkiness, a certain voile feel; cool and quite open (hollow?), feels fresh then back to the manzanilla salt/nut thing.

    Doing well later, nutty, salty and surprisingly lean, tense in part and airy.
